@cyanheads/oecd-mcp-server
Search, explore, and query 1,500+ OECD statistical datasets (national accounts, employment, trade, education, health) via SDMX via MCP. STDIO or Streamable HTTP.
Public Hosted Server: https://oecd.caseyjhand.com/mcp
Tools
Five discovery and data tools plus two SQL analytics tools for large query results:
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
oecd_list_agencies | List OECD SDMX agencies with their directorate and the number of dataflows each publishes |
oecd_search_datasets | Search 1,500+ OECD dataflows by keyword or theme |
oecd_get_dataset_info | Fetch a dataflow's dimensions, key order, and codelist references |
oecd_get_dimension_values | Fetch valid codes and labels for one dimension (countries, measures, frequencies) |
oecd_query_dataset | Fetch observations filtered by dimension key and time range; spills large results to DataCanvas |
oecd_dataframe_describe | List DataCanvas tables and columns staged by a prior oecd_query_dataset spill |
oecd_dataframe_query | Run a read-only SQL SELECT against DataCanvas tables |

oecd_get_dataset_info
Inspect a dataflow's structure before querying.
- Returns all dimensions in key order (position 1, 2, 3 …) — dimension order is required to construct the dot-delimited key for
oecd_query_dataset - Each dimension carries its concept name from the datastructure's concept scheme, so
INSTR_ASSETreads as "Financial instruments and non-financial assets" rather than repeating the id. A dimension the scheme does not cover keeps the id - Shows codelist references for each dimension — pass to
oecd_get_dimension_valuesto resolve human-readable names to SDMX codes - Surfaces
NonProductionDataflowflag — marks experimental or deprecated dataflows - Resolves a
flow_refwhose id prefix names no datastructure of its own by asking the dataflow for its structure —OECD.CFE.EDS,DSD_REG_LAB@DF_RATESis backed byDSD_REG_LABOUR, and answers here rather than reporting the dataflow as missing - Required before calling
oecd_query_dataseton an unfamiliar dataflow

oecd_query_dataset
Fetch observations from an OECD dataflow filtered by dimension key and time range.
- Accepts a dot-delimited key (e.g.
A.USA+DEU.B1GQ_R.PC.) where empty segments are wildcards and+separates multiple values - Optional
start_period/end_periodbound the time range (ISO format:2010,2010-Q1) - Decodes SDMX-JSON index notation (
0:0:2:3:0) into human-readable row objects with dimension labels - Observation attributes (
UNIT_MULT,OBS_STATUS,PRICE_BASE,DECIMALS, …) each become their own column, so an estimated or break-flagged point is distinguishable from a confirmed one valuearrives already multiplied by the observation'sUNIT_MULT— a GDP figure OECD publishes as26054.614billions comes back as26054614000000. Every row carriesvalue_scale, the power of ten applied; divide by it for the figure as OECD published it- Every response row includes
source: "OECD"per OECD terms of use - Small results (few countries, narrow time range): every observation is returned inline, in
structuredContentand in the rendered table alike — nocanvas_id, andtruncatedis omitted rather than set tofalse - Large results (multi-country, multi-year time-series) with
CANVAS_PROVIDER_TYPE=duckdb: a leading preview slice pluscanvas_id+truncated: true— useoecd_dataframe_describeto list tables, thenoecd_dataframe_queryfor SQL analytics - Large results without DataCanvas: there is nowhere to stage the remainder, so every observation still comes back in
structuredContent, while the rendered table stops at the same preview budget a canvas would have used — the response reportscontent_table_cappedand the number of rows it showed. Narrow the key or thestart_period/end_periodrange to shrink the result itself
oecd_dataframe_describe / oecd_dataframe_query
SQL analytics over observation data staged by oecd_query_dataset.
When oecd_query_dataset returns truncated: true, the full result is staged on a DuckDB-backed DataCanvas. Pass the canvas_id to:
oecd_dataframe_describe— list staged table names and their columns. Run this first to discover the schema before writing SQL.oecd_dataframe_query— run a single-statement SQL SELECT. Supports aggregates, window functions, GROUP BY, ORDER BY, and standard DuckDB SQL.
Requires CANVAS_PROVIDER_TYPE=duckdb. Read-only: writes, DDL, and system catalog access are rejected.
Typical workflow for a large query:
oecd_query_dataset → { canvas_id, table_name, truncated: true, rows: [preview...] }
→ oecd_dataframe_describe(canvas_id) → table/column names
→ oecd_dataframe_query(canvas_id, "SELECT REF_AREA, AVG(value) FROM spilled_... GROUP BY REF_AREA")

OECD-specific:
- Keyless access — no API key required; OECD SDMX 2.1 REST API is fully public
- Covers 1,500+ dataflows across 20+ OECD statistical departments (national accounts, employment, inflation, trade, education, health, environment, taxation, inequality)
- Delegated dataflows resolved end to end — the entries OECD catalogues on one service root but defines on another (Trade in Value Added, the DAC creditor-reporting aid series) follow the catalog's own link for structure, codes, and observations, with the target checked against the configured origin before any request goes out
- Codes read at the revision the dataflow references — a codelist moves on independently of the datastructures using it, so a dimension's values come from the version its structure names rather than the endpoint's current latest, and never include a code the dimension rejects
AllDimensionsobservation mode — one-pass SDMX-JSON decoding into flat row objects; no nested series key reconstructionoecd_query_datasetmaterializes large observation sets (multi-country time-series) on a DuckDB DataCanvas for in-conversation SQL analytics- OECD source attribution (
source: "OECD") on every observation row per OECD terms of use
Agent-friendly output:
- Workflow-aware tool surface —
flow_reffrom search flows directly into info, values, and query tools without reconstruction - Spill signaling —
truncated: true+canvas_idtells the agent to switch to SQL instead of parsing a truncated inline list - Full SDMX decoding server-side — agents see
{ REF_AREA: "United States", MEASURE: "Gross domestic product", UNIT_MULT: "Billions", value: 26054614000000, value_scale: 1000000000 }, not raw index arrays

Configuration
All configuration is validated at startup via Zod schemas in src/config/server-config.ts. Key environment variables:
| Variable |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|
OECD_BASE_URL | OECD SDMX REST API base URL. Must be an https origin that answers directly — no redirect is followed, so a plaintext http:// origin fails instead of being upgraded to https. | https://sdmx.oecd.org/public/rest |
OECD_TIMEOUT_MS | Per-request timeout in milliseconds. | 30000 |
CANVAS_PROVIDER_TYPE | Canvas engine. Set to duckdb so a large oecd_query_dataset result spills to a queryable table instead of just capping the rendered preview — unset, every row still comes back in structuredContent, only the rendered table is capped. | none |
MCP_TRANSPORT_TYPE | Transport: stdio or http. | stdio |
MCP_HTTP_PORT | Port for HTTP server. | 3010 |
MCP_AUTH_MODE | Auth mode: none, jwt, or oauth. | none |
MCP_LOG_LEVEL | Log level (RFC 5424). | info |
LOGS_DIR | Directory for log files (Node.js only). | <project-root>/logs |
OTEL_ENABLED | Enable OpenTelemetry instrumentation. | false |
See .env.example for the full list of optional overrides.
